Navajo Prep won against Zuni on Tuesday with 11 runs and they decided to stick to that run total again on Thursday. The Eagles blew past the Thoreau Hawks 11-1. The Eagles might be getting used to big wins seeing as the team has won eight matches by six runs or more this season.
Navajo Prep let Jashyro Bileen and Khol Johnson run wild. Bileen went 3-for-4 with four stolen bases, two runs, and one double, while Johnson went 3-for-4 with one home run, two runs, and one stolen base. Johnson is on a roll when it comes to stolen bases, as he's now snagged at least one in each of the last nine games he's played. The team also got some help courtesy of Koltyn Holyan, who went 3-for-4 with three stolen bases and two runs.
Navajo Prep is on a roll lately: they've won 11 of their last 14 contests. That's provided a massive bump to their 12-13 record this season. The wins came thanks in part to their hitting performance across that stretch, as they averaged 10.9 runs over those games. As for Thoreau, their defeat was their third straight on the road, which dropped their record down to 5-15.
Navajo Prep will have a chance to go back-to-back against the Hawks: the pair will be back at it again later today.
